页面里没有用任何服务器控件
但想抛出某种查库后的验证错误信息也就是alert一次由于没有form  runat=server,好像Page.ClientScript这个无效
用Response.Write的话页面会变形请问有什么好办法吗?

解决方案 »

  1.   

            public static void Alert(Page page, string message)
            {
                try
                {
                    page.ClientScript.RegisterStartupScript(typeof(Page), "JavascriptAlert", "<script type='text/javascript'>alert(\"" + message + "\");</script>");
                }
                catch
                {
                    throw;
                }
            }定义个弹出方法抛出异常时候 直接调用
    XX.ALERT(this,"异常错误")
      

  2.   

    都说了用Page.ClientScript都无效
      

  3.   

    Response.Write("<script type='text/javascript'>alert(\"" + message + "\");</script>")